Transaction 32511f73026d09334bfdd6c762a38e1c14063fb50963f3764232d99092a2c65c
1 Input
1 Output
-
32511f73026d09334bfdd6c762a38e1c14063fb50963f3764232d99092a2c65c:0
- value
- 3010387387476
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ab3c667f8b9ffa265accb4cee93a2bf18874d74 OP_EQUALVERIFY OP_CHECKSIG
- address
- DAVV6NYWS42N4gf7shQRQNY3kqeGShLtjX